This is Renna and her batty companion Miemriri. They might seem unlikely sompanions but think on this. If a bat sleeps in the day who will guard his perch, when the faerie goes into her nightly reverie who will watch over her tiny being? Unlikely as they may seem this pair is perfectly matched! I chose to use a large fruit bat for this piece. They might look scary to alot of people and there are so many myths that make them seem very fearsome creatures. What those stories fail to tell you is that alot of bats tend to be fruit and insect eaters. I think it's a little harder to be afraid of a bat when you know it's basically a vegitarian. We have bats all around our area and have never had a single bad encounter with one. (we are going to be building bat houses here soon as alot of the places they used to nest have been cut down or built over in our area. There is so much detail in this piece. From the individual hairs on the bat to the gossamer wings of the fae. The painted has been varnished to a high gloss finish. It is an original acrylic painting on Masonite/gessoed art board.
